Output 2e13c19502889a2f15cde462012713fcf5b51ab756bc29857d076a5a5a28f009:0

value
66659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ff68bab023f82b545984844f1f1d7d480d749e OP_EQUAL
address
3HvBVdfjohXxA8o9Tfkm4mbJqyH9eiWHjD
transaction
2e13c19502889a2f15cde462012713fcf5b51ab756bc29857d076a5a5a28f009
spent
true